About

The ETF with the financial product symbol AMES.XETRA refers to the Amundi MSCI Emerging Markets UCITS ETF DR, traded on the XETRA exchange. This ETF aims to replicate the performance of the MSCI Emerging Markets Index, providing exposure to a broad range of companies from emerging market countries. It's a popular choice for investors seeking diversified exposure to the growth potential of emerging economies.

Factors

Underlying Asset Performance: The price of an AMES.XETRA ETF is directly tied to the performance of the assets it tracks, like an index or basket of stocks.

Supply and Demand: Higher demand for the ETF generally pushes the price up, while increased selling pressure can lead to a price decrease.

Expense Ratio: While not a direct price driver, the ETF's expense ratio affects its overall return and perceived value compared to similar options.

Market Sentiment: Broad market optimism or pessimism can significantly impact investor appetite for ETFs, including AMES.XETRA.

Currency Fluctuations: If the ETF holds assets denominated in a different currency, exchange rate changes will affect its price when converted back to EUR.
